2024-01-06Auto merge of #119478 - bjorn3:no_serialize_specialization, r=wesleywiserbors-96/+205
Avoid specialization in the metadata serialization code With the exception of a perf-only specialization for byte slices and byte vectors. This uses the same trick of introducing a new trait and having the Encodable and Decodable derives add a bound to it as used for TyEncoder/TyDecoder. The new code is clearer about which encoder/decoder uses which impl and it reduces the dependency of rustc on specialization, making it easier to remove support for specialization entirely or turn it into a construct that is only allowed for perf optimizations if we decide to do this.

2024-01-05Auto merge of #119192 - michaelwoerister:mcp533-push, r=cjgillotbors-2/+28
Replace a number of FxHashMaps/Sets with stable-iteration-order alternatives This PR replaces almost all of the remaining `FxHashMap`s in query results with either `FxIndexMap` or `UnordMap`. The only case that is missing is the `EffectiveVisibilities` struct which turned out to not be straightforward to transform. Once that is done too, we can remove the `HashStable` implementation from `HashMap`. The first commit adds the `StableCompare` trait which is a companion trait to `StableOrd`. Some types like `Symbol` can be compared in a cross-session stable way, but their `Ord` implementation is not stable. In such cases, a `StableCompare` implementation can be provided to offer a lightweight way for stable sorting. The more heavyweight option is to sort via `ToStableHashKey`, but then sorting needs to have access to a stable hashing context and `ToStableHashKey` can also be expensive as in the case of `Symbol` where it has to allocate a `String`. The rest of the commits are rather mechanical and don't overlap, so they are best reviewed individually. Part of [MCP 533](https://github.com/rust-lang/compiler-team/issues/533).

2023-12-24Auto merge of #119139 - michaelwoerister:cleanup-stable-source-file-id, ↵bors-64/+81
r=cjgillot Unify SourceFile::name_hash and StableSourceFileId This PR adapts the existing `StableSourceFileId` type so that it can be used instead of the `name_hash` field of `SourceFile`. This simplifies a few things that were kind of duplicated before. The PR should also fix issues https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/112700 and https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/115835, but I was not able to reproduce these issues in a regression test. As far as I can tell, the root cause of these issues is that the id of the originating crate is not hashed in the `HashStable` impl of `Span` and thus cache entries that should have been considered invalidated were loaded. After this PR, the `stable_id` field of `SourceFile` includes information about the originating crate, so that ICE should not occur anymore.
2023-12-23Specialize DefPathHash table to skip crate IDsMark Rousskov-2/+0
Instead, we store just the local crate hash as a bare u64. On decoding, we recombine it with the crate's stable crate ID stored separately in metadata. The end result is that we save ~8 bytes/DefIndex in metadata size. One key detail here is that we no longer distinguish in encoded metadata between present and non-present DefPathHashes. It used to be highly likely we could distinguish as we used DefPathHash::default(), an all-zero representation. However in theory even that is fallible as nothing strictly prevents the StableCrateId from being zero.

2023-12-11Auto merge of #117758 - Urgau:lint_pointer_trait_comparisons, r=davidtwcobors-0/+2
Add lint against ambiguous wide pointer comparisons This PR is the resolution of https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/106447 decided in https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/117717 by T-lang. ## `ambiguous_wide_pointer_comparisons` *warn-by-default* The `ambiguous_wide_pointer_comparisons` lint checks comparison of `*const/*mut ?Sized` as the operands. ### Example ```rust let ab = (A, B); let a = &ab.0 as *const dyn T; let b = &ab.1 as *const dyn T; let _ = a == b; ``` ### Explanation The comparison includes metadata which may not be expected. ------- This PR also drops `clippy::vtable_address_comparisons` which is superseded by this one. ~~One thing: is the current naming right? `invalid` seems a bit too much.~~ Fixes https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/117717
